Hi folks, I'm trying to figure out why only one bulb on each side illuminates when the lights are turned on. It seems there are 2 wires from the kick panel feeding them; green and Green-orange. The green is fine, but the Green-orange gets no power. I've traced back as far as j/b 3 and I'm beginning to wonder if they don't light without the engine running... (engine not yet built/installed)

Anybody any ideas?

Not quite sure what the tails are supposed to work like anymore, but as far as I can tell from the schematics both tail bulbs should be connected to the green wire for general market models and only one is for german market cars.
The german market model should have an additional tail bulb fed through a green-orange wire on a separate connector. That additional bulb is fused separately by the TAIL LH fuse (non german models only have one TAIL fuse).

Try and see if you can trace the green/orange wire back to J/B1, connector 1J. If you can and you have an empty fuse holder next to the DOME fuse, try sticking a 10A fuse in it.

Thanks Ivan, that's interesting and it's got me looking at the schematics again. This car definitely has a green wire feeding the two innermost bulbs, and the Green-orange feeding the 2 outer ones. Both are traced back to 1d on jb1.... More investigation required I think...

1D would be where you expect the wires to go. What I'm confused about is where all those bulbs go.
My zenki tails have 4 in total as far as I remember: tail+brake, reverse, fog, indicator.

Ah, mine has two doubles, so tail/brake, reverse, tail/brake then indicator. No fog light (although it looks like someone butchered a foglight in there), they mustn't get fog in japan
